package/libxml2: add patch for CVE-2025-6170

This fixes the following vulnerability:

- CVE-2025-6170

    A flaw was found in the interactive shell of the xmllint command-line
    tool, used for parsing XML files. When a user inputs an overly long
    command, the program does not check the input size properly, which can
    cause it to crash. This issue might allow attackers to run harmful
    code in rare configurations without modern protections.

+diff --git a/debugXML.c b/debugXML.c
+index ed56b0f8..452b9573 100644
+--- a/debugXML.c
++++ b/debugXML.c
+@@ -1033,6 +1033,10 @@ xmlCtxtDumpOneNode(xmlDebugCtxtPtr ctxt, xmlNodePtr node)
+     xmlCtxtGenericNodeCheck(ctxt, node);
+ }
+ 
++#define MAX_PROMPT_SIZE     500
++#define MAX_ARG_SIZE        400
++#define MAX_COMMAND_SIZE    100
++
+ /**
+  * xmlCtxtDumpNode:
+  * @output:  the FILE * for the output
+@@ -2795,10 +2799,10 @@ void
+ xmlShell(xmlDocPtr doc, const char *filename, xmlShellReadlineFunc input,
+          FILE * output)
+ {
+-    char prompt[500] = "/ > ";
++    char prompt[MAX_PROMPT_SIZE] = "/ > ";
+     char *cmdline = NULL, *cur;
+-    char command[100];
+-    char arg[400];
++    char command[MAX_COMMAND_SIZE];
++    char arg[MAX_ARG_SIZE];
+     int i;
+     xmlShellCtxtPtr ctxt;
+     xmlXPathObjectPtr list;
+@@ -2856,7 +2860,8 @@ xmlShell(xmlDocPtr doc, const char *filename, xmlShellReadlineFunc input,
+             cur++;
+         i = 0;
+         while ((*cur != ' ') && (*cur != '\t') &&
+-               (*cur != '\n') && (*cur != '\r')) {
++               (*cur != '\n') && (*cur != '\r') &&
++               (i < (MAX_COMMAND_SIZE - 1))) {
+             if (*cur == 0)
+                 break;
+             command[i++] = *cur++;
+@@ -2871,7 +2876,7 @@ xmlShell(xmlDocPtr doc, const char *filename, xmlShellReadlineFunc input,
+         while ((*cur == ' ') || (*cur == '\t'))
+             cur++;
+         i = 0;
+-        while ((*cur != '\n') && (*cur != '\r') && (*cur != 0)) {
++        while ((*cur != '\n') && (*cur != '\r') && (*cur != 0) && (i < (MAX_ARG_SIZE-1))) {
+             if (*cur == 0)
+                 break;
+             arg[i++] = *cur++;
